About South Park
South Park spreads across 1.41 square miles in South Los Angeles, bounded by Vernon Avenue to the north, Central Avenue to the east, Slauson Avenue to the south, and the Harbor Freeway to the west. The neighborhood’s centerpiece remains the historic South Park Recreation Center on Avalon Boulevard, a 20-acre green space established in 1899 that serves as the community’s gathering spot with its pool, ball fields, and basketball courts.
Around 32,000 residents call this area home, with a young median age of 23 and a predominantly Latino and African American population. Craftsman-style bungalows line quiet residential streets where families have deep roots and community connections run strong. The neighborhood sits close to USC and historic Central Avenue, making it both affordable and centrally located for South LA residents.
